Smart Vehicle Features Enhancing Safety

Modern automobiles are increasingly equipped with advanced safety features. Innovations such as automatic emergency braking systems, blind-spot detection, and adaptive cruise control provide real-time support to drivers. These features significantly reduce the likelihood of accidents by aiding in maintaining vehicle control. The automotive industry’s trend toward achieving fully autonomous vehicles exemplifies its commitment to minimizing human intervention and the errors associated with it. The continual advancements in this domain are setting new safety standards, pushing for a future where vehicles are not only a mode of transport but a partner in safety.

Importance of Real-Time Traffic Monitoring

Effective traffic management relies heavily on real-time data to prevent accidents and alleviate congestion. This data is sourced from an interconnected network of sensors, cameras, and communication devices that monitor road conditions instantly. Real-time traffic monitoring systems enhance the decision-making of traffic authorities, allowing for swift interventions in critical situations. As cities become smarter, the implementation of such technologies is on the rise, delivering improved urban mobility and safety. Apps and Wearables for Driver Safety

With the rise of mobile technology and personal devices, apps and wearables have become integral to promoting driver safety. Mobile applications provide real-time feedback on driving behavior and alert users to potential hazards. They assist drivers in improving their skills by highlighting safe driving practices. Furthermore, wearables that track health and alertness add a layer of precaution by monitoring vital signs and fatigue levels. These technologies collectively form a proactive approach to ensuring drivers maintain optimal performance while behind the wheel, enhancing overall safety and driver accountability.

Future Prospects for Road Safety Technology

Looking forward, the prospects for road safety continue to evolve with technological advancements. Anticipated innovations in vehicle-to-everything (V2X) communication promise to enhance connectivity between vehicles and infrastructure, offering even greater safety capabilities. Improved and more intelligent infrastructure paired with smart city initiatives will further bolster these efforts. Additionally, ongoing advancements in AI, machine learning, and sensor technology will continue to refine the predictive capabilities essential for accident prevention. Public education campaigns and increased awareness of these technologies will empower consumers, ensuring widespread adoption and trust in these life-saving innovations.
